As a business analyst, effective requirements elicitation is crucial for the success of any project. Here are the top five skills that are essential for this process:
1. Active Listening
Importance: Active listening ensures that the analyst fully understands the stakeholders’ needs, concerns, and expectations. This skill involves paying close attention, understanding the context, and clarifying ambiguities.
Application: During interviews and meetings, focus on what the stakeholders are saying without interrupting. Reflect back what you’ve heard to confirm understanding and ask follow-up questions to delve deeper into their requirements (Muglee).
2. Effective Communication
Importance: Clear and effective communication is essential for conveying requirements accurately and ensuring all stakeholders are on the same page. This includes both verbal and written communication.
Application: Use clear, concise language when documenting requirements and communicating with stakeholders. Ensure that all communications are free from jargon and tailored to the audience’s level of understanding. Regular updates and feedback loops are also crucial (Muglee) (Muglee).
3. Analytical Thinking
Importance: Analytical thinking enables the business analyst to dissect complex information, identify patterns, and understand the underlying needs behind the stated requirements.
Application: Apply various analytical techniques such as SWOT analysis, root cause analysis, and data modeling to break down requirements into manageable parts. This helps in identifying dependencies, potential issues, and areas for improvement (Muglee).
4. Facilitation Skills
Importance: Facilitation skills are vital for guiding group discussions, workshops, and meetings to elicit requirements from multiple stakeholders efficiently.
Application: Lead workshops and focus groups to gather requirements collaboratively. Use facilitation techniques to manage group dynamics, encourage participation from all stakeholders, and achieve consensus. This involves setting clear agendas, managing time effectively, and ensuring that discussions stay focused on the objectives (Muglee) (Muglee).
5. Problem-Solving Skills
Importance: Problem-solving skills are essential for addressing challenges and conflicts that arise during the requirements elicitation process.
Application: Identify potential issues early in the elicitation process and develop strategies to address them. Use techniques like brainstorming, root cause analysis, and scenario analysis to find solutions that align with stakeholder needs and project constraints. Validate requirements through use cases and prototypes to ensure they are feasible and meet the project’s goals (Muglee).
By developing and honing these skills, business analysts can effectively gather, analyze, and document requirements, ensuring that the project deliverables align with stakeholder expectations and contribute to the overall success of the project.